📝 Jajpur District Court Junior Clerk, Typist, Stenographer, Salaried Amin Detailed Notification Guide
Overview of Jajpur District Court Recruitment 2026
The Office of the District Judge, Jajpur, has invited applications for the recruitment of 25 vacancies across various clerical and ministerial positions. Eligible candidates must submit their applications through the prescribed offline mode by the deadline of 17 July 2026. Interested individuals are advised to verify their eligibility against the official advertisement (No. 02/2026) before drafting their application.
Vacancy Breakdown
| Post Name | Total Posts |
|---|---|
| Junior Clerk-cum-Copyist | 17 |
| Junior Typist | 3 |
| Stenographer Grade-III | 4 |
| Salaried Amin | 1 |
Eligibility and Educational Requirements
Applicants must ensure they possess the necessary qualifications as of the date of notification:
- Junior Clerk-cum-Copyist: Bachelor’s degree (+3) or equivalent, plus a Diploma in Computer Application (DCA).
- Junior Typist: Bachelor’s degree (+3), DCA, and English typewriting speed of 40 WPM.
- Stenographer Grade-III: Bachelor’s degree (+3), DCA, and shorthand speed of 80 WPM with 40 WPM in typewriting.
- Salaried Amin: Matriculation or equivalent with mandatory Revenue Inspector (RI) training.
Age Parameters and Salary Scale
The age limit for all candidates is 18 to 42 years as of the specified cutoff date. Age relaxation applies to reserved categories (SC/ST/SEBC/Women) by 5 years, and 10 years for PwD and Ex-Servicemen. Salary is commensurate with the ORSP Rules, 2017, ranging from Level-4 to Level-7.

Selection Process
The recruitment process consists of a written examination, a practical test in computer science and technical knowledge, shorthand/typing tests (where applicable), and a Viva-Voce test for shortlisted candidates.
How to Apply for Jajpur District Court Recruitment
Candidates must follow these steps to ensure their application is processed correctly:
- Download the official application format from the Jajpur District Court website.
- Fill in the form with accurate personal and educational data.
- Attach self-attested copies of all educational certificates, ID proof, and passport-sized photographs.
- Submit the completed application package via Registered/Speed Post to the office of the District Judge, Jajpur, before the 17 July 2026 deadline.
Warning: Applications received after the closing date or incomplete applications will be summarily rejected. Always maintain a photocopy of your submitted application for your personal records.
